About

Monte Sano State Park Campground occupies a scenic plateau on Monte Sano mountain, just minutes from downtown Huntsville. The campground divides into three site categories: primitive tent-only sites tucked into wooded areas, standard water and electric sites with gravel pads and 30/50 amp service, and premium full-hookup sites offering water, electric, and sewer connections along the bluff with views. Two modern bathhouses provide hot showers and coin-operated laundry facilities. The park surrounds campers with over 20 miles of hiking and mountain biking trails through hardwood forests. A Japanese garden, disc golf course, playground, and the Von Braun Planetarium provide diversions beyond the trails. The camp store stocks firewood and essentials, staying open year-round from 8am to 5pm. Two dump stations serve RV campers. Reservations are strongly recommended, especially for weekends when a two-night minimum applies. Holiday weekends require three-night stays. The improved campground enforces a 14-day stay limit from March 1 through November 1, while primitive sites cap at five consecutive nights year-round. RVers should avoid GPS-directed routes via Bankhead Parkway and follow official directions from Governors Drive instead.

Directions

From Huntsville: Stay left to South Memorial Parkway. Take the right-hand exit to Governors Drive. Turn left onto Governors Drive. Follow Governors Drive up the mountain to Monte Sano Blvd. Turn left onto Monte Sano Blvd. Continue 2.5 miles and then turn right onto Nolen Ave. Follow Nolen Ave one mile until you arrive at the Park Entrance Gate. Do NOT use GPS or Bankhead Parkway if pulling a camper or RV.
